Temple Mount Faithful Hold Cornerstone Ceremony
http://www.israelnn.com/news.php3?id=109065 ^ | August 3 2006

Posted on 08/04/2006 1:31:00 PM PDT by markedmannerf

(IsraelNN.com) Temple Mount Faithful organization activists on Thursday morning held their annual Tisha B’Av cornerstone ceremony near the Mugrabi Gate after police ruled they are banned from the Mount.

The participants wished to lay a cornerstone for the Third Temple on the Mount, today, Tisha B’Av, the day marking the destruction of the First and Second Temples, but non-Muslim worshipers are prohibited from entering the Mount today by police.
